Scholar-generated biography

Ewen K Campbell is a Royal Society University Research Fellow at the University of Edinburgh, specializing in Chemistry, Spectroscopy, and Molecular ions. His research focuses on the laboratory study of molecular ions, particularly in the context of interstellar chemistry. He investigates the electronic and absorption spectra of ions such as C60+ and their role in diffuse interstellar bands (DIBs). His work bridges laboratory spectroscopy with astronomical observations, aiming to identify carriers of DIBs and understand their astrophysical implications. Campbell's research also includes gas-phase spectroscopy of ions in cryogenic traps and the development of advanced mass spectrometry techniques for analyzing molecular ions.
